#219259 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#219259 is composed of 12.9% red, 57.3%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 39%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 149.7 degrees, a saturation of 63.1% and a lightness of 35.1%. #219259 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ffb2 with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#219259 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#219259 has RGB values of R:33, G:146,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 2200153.

Shades and Tints of #219259
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#219259
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585b59 is the less saturated color, while #05ae59 is the most saturated one.
